## Auth for the GarageGlance feed

Hey future maintainer — the occupancy feed from the Westpool garages sits behind the Stallkeeper gateway. Every poll needs an API key in the `X-Stall-Auth` header; unauthenticated requests just get cached counts from an hour ago. The key we currently use for the ingest worker is below.

gateway credential: kto23_LX9A4ys6i4nzHtpOLNLodKK

Heads up: the Papertrail invoice renderer started spitting out blank second pages on CI, but only on the Linux runners. Turns out the Quillstone font cache isn't warming before the render job, so glyph metrics come back zeroed. I added a pre-warm step in the Mistvale pipeline config. Repro against the failing run — its trace token is right below.

build token for kagaf-hahof: htk14_9d3d4d26d7d8de

This alert fires when the Tumbleden laundry-locker access flow fails for more than 2% of unlock attempts over ten minutes. Typical causes: expired access tokens on kiosk firmware, or the Keymaster service lagging behind locker state updates. First steps: check the Keymaster health dashboard, then confirm kiosk firmware version in the fleet panel. Most incidents self-resolve after a Keymaster restart. If the failure rate stays elevated past thirty minutes, notify the access platform team at this address.

escalation mailbox, hahag-yagaf: ralir@paliqhq.test

Wiki (Managers Only) — Ashfell Components: Customer Concentration. One client, Drummark Industrial, accounts for 48% of annual revenue and 60% of gross margin. Contract renews in March. Loss scenarios were modeled last quarter; all show material impact within two quarters. Sales is pursuing three mid-size prospects to dilute exposure. The board should read the confidential note appended below.

confidential, kagup-bafog: Fraaxax Group is in early talks to buy Soroxox Group for about $343.8 million. The Olidor launch date is June 14, and nothing goes to the press before then. Legal wants the Aldmirek Logistics term sheet signed before July 23.